Harry Hadley, 86, of Richland, was born May 22, 1921 in Benton City, WA and passed away January 28, 2008 at Kadlec Hospital.

Harry spent 28 years as a manager at the Hanford site. After retirement Harry and Jewell traveled the States for 14 years before returning to Richland.

He was preceded in death by his parents and by two daughters, Linda and Brenda. He is survived by his wife and love of his life for 52 years, Jewell; five grandchildren and five great-grandchildren.
